Home
last modified time | relevance | path

Searched refs:mps_mtx (Results 1 – 6 of 6) sorted by relevance

/freebsd/sys/dev/mps/
H A Dmps.c175 if (mtx_owned(&sc->mps_mtx) && sleep_flag == CAN_SLEEP) in mps_diag_reset()
176 msleep(&sc->msleep_fake_chan, &sc->mps_mtx, 0, in mps_diag_reset()
209 if (mtx_owned(&sc->mps_mtx) && sleep_flag == CAN_SLEEP) in mps_diag_reset()
210 msleep(&sc->msleep_fake_chan, &sc->mps_mtx, 0, in mps_diag_reset()
816 mtx_assert(&sc->mps_mtx, MA_OWNED); in mps_reinit()
933 if (mtx_owned(&sc->mps_mtx) && sleep_flag == CAN_SLEEP) in mps_wait_db_ack()
934 msleep(&sc->msleep_fake_chan, &sc->mps_mtx, 0, in mps_wait_db_ack()
1102 mtx_assert(&sc->mps_mtx, MA_OWNED); in mps_enqueue_request()
1498 BD_LOCKFUNCARG(&sc->mps_mtx), in mps_alloc_requests()
1521 callout_init_mtx(&cm->cm_callout, &sc->mps_mtx, 0); in mps_alloc_requests()
[all …]
H A Dmpsvar.h367 struct mtx mps_mtx; member
642 mtx_lock(&sc->mps_mtx); in mps_lock()
648 mtx_unlock(&sc->mps_mtx); in mps_unlock()
H A Dmps_sas.c733 unit, &sc->mps_mtx, reqs, reqs, sassc->devq); in mps_attach_sas()
917 mtx_assert(&sassc->sc->mps_mtx, MA_OWNED); in mpssas_action()
1056 mtx_assert(&sc->mps_mtx, MA_OWNED); in mpssas_complete_all_commands()
1154 mtx_assert(&sc->mps_mtx, MA_OWNED); in mpssas_tm_timeout()
1546 mtx_assert(&sc->mps_mtx, MA_OWNED); in mpssas_scsiio_timeout()
1630 mtx_assert(&sc->mps_mtx, MA_OWNED); in mpssas_action_scsiio()
1978 mtx_assert(&sc->mps_mtx, MA_OWNED); in mpssas_scsiio_complete()
3046 mtx_assert(&sassc->sc->mps_mtx, MA_OWNED); in mpssas_action_resetdev()
3085 mtx_assert(&sc->mps_mtx, MA_OWNED); in mpssas_resetdev_complete()
H A Dmps_user.c1446 error = msleep(ctx, &sc->mps_mtx, PCATCH, "mpswait", 0); in mps_diag_register()
2253 msleep_ret = msleep(&sc->port_enable_complete, &sc->mps_mtx, PRIBIO, in mps_ioctl()
H A Dmps_sas_lsi.c843 msleep(&sc->msleep_fake_chan, &sc->mps_mtx, 0, in mpssas_get_sas_address_for_sata_disk()
H A Dmps_mapping.c1961 mtx_assert(&sc->mps_mtx, MA_OWNED); in mps_mapping_check_devices()